But there are also higher and lower tides that happen roughly twice a month – or twice in each full rotation of the Moon around the Earth. The high tides generally happen every 12 and a half hours. But at the same time, on the opposite side of the Earth, the same thing is happening due to the combination of the Moon’s gravitational pull and the centrifugal force from both of them spinning. When the Earth is facing the Moon it pulls the oceans towards it. The most common compressed format for digital images is JPEG (the ‘Joint Photographic Experts Group’ format, usually written as. The Nike Cosmic Unity has very consistent traction across both indoor and outdoor terrains. Since debuting a few years ago, Zoom Strobel has been one of my favorite cushioning setups and provides a general nice balance of balanced supportive cushioning with a sufficient amount of court feel.īack to the basics - effective herringbone traction One cool aspect is that from inspecting the bottom of the shoe you can clearly see the air cushioning layout from the outsole.
